@import url(404.css);
@import url(mainnav.css);
@import url(news.css);
@import url(search.css);

/************************* HTML BODY **********************/
html, body {
	margin: 0;
	padding: 0;
	height: 100%;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 0.81em;
	line-height: 1.6em;
	background-color: #ececea;
}

/************************* STRUCTURE **********************/

#distance { 
	width: 1px;
	height: 50%;
	margin-bottom: -245px;
	float: left;
}

#search_container {
	width: 300px;
	top: -35px;
	left: 715px;
	position: absolute;
}

#container {
	padding: 0;
	margin: 0 auto;
	width: 975px;
	height: 488px;
	border: 1px #000 solid;
	border-right: 3px #88012a solid;
	clear:left;
	position: relative;
	background-color: #FFF;
}

#flash {
	width: 348px;
	height: 488px;
	padding: 0;
	margin: 0;
	float: left;
}

#mainnav {
	width: 168px;
	height: 486px;
	margin: 0;
	padding: 0;
	float: left;
	background-color: #eeeeee;
	border: 1px #fff solid;
}

#content {
	width: 426px;
	height: 468px;
	margin: 0;
	padding: 5px 15px 15px 15px;
	float: left;
	border-left: 1px #cccccc solid;
	overflow: auto;
	position: relative;
}

/************************* TEXT **********************/

h1 {
	font-size: 130%;
	border-bottom: 1px #999 solid;
	color: #88012a;
	padding: 0 0 5px 0;
	margin-bottom: 10px;
}

h2 {
	font-size: 100%;
	color: #88012a;
}

h3 {
}

p {
}

/************************* LINKS **********************/

a {
	text-decoration:underline;
	color: #88012a;
}

a:hover {
	text-decoration: none;
	color: #000;
}

/************************* TABLES **********************/

#content td img {
	padding: 0 10px 0 0;
}

#content td {
	padding: 0 0 15px 0;
	vertical-align: top;
}

/************************* OTHERS **********************/

.rss {
	background-image: url(/web/grafik/rss.gif);
	background-repeat: no-repeat;
	background-position: left 3px;
	display: block;
	padding: 2px 0 2px 20px;
	margin: 0 0 5px 0;
}

.rss_dagbog {
	background-image: url(/web/grafik/rss.gif);
	background-repeat: no-repeat;
	background-position: left 3px;
	display: block;
	padding: 2px 0 2px 20px;
	margin: 0 0 5px 0;
	position: absolute;
	left: 355px;
	top: 30px;
}

.rss_news {
	background-image: url(/web/grafik/rss.gif);
	background-repeat: no-repeat;
	background-position: left 3px;
	display: block;
	padding: 2px 0 2px 20px;
	margin: -2px 0 0 10px;
	float: left;
}

.clear {
	clear: both;
}

.noshow {
	display: none;
}


/************************* SEARCH **********************/

#search_container #search {
	margin: 0;
	padding: 0;
	border: 0;	
}

#search_container #search legend {
	margin: 0;
	padding: 0;
	display: none;
}


#search_container #search .txtfield{
	width: 180px;
	height: 15px;
	padding: 3px 2px 3px 10px;
	background-color: #EFEFEF;
	border: 1px solid #ccc;
	font-size: 10px;
	float: left;
}

#search_container #search .submitbtn{
	width: 64px;
	height: 23px;
	margin: 0 0 0 3px;
	background-image: url(/web/grafik/knap_search_submit.gif);
	background-repeat: no-repeat;
	text-align: center;
	font-size: 10px;
	color: #363636;
	border: 0;
	float: left;
}

